Abua Odual

Background Information

The Abua/Odual LGA is one of the 23 LGAs in Rivers State with its headquarter at Ayama, Abua Central. It is located in the Rivers West Senatorial district, and has 13 political wards. The LGA was created from the former AhoadaLGA on 1st October 1991. It is bounded in the north by Ahoada East and Ahoada West LGAs , in the south by DegemaLGA, in the east by Emohua LGA, and in the west byBayelsa State The LGA occupies a land mass of 704 sq. km. The projected population of the LGA in 2020 was 451,918 spread among 65 communities. The predominant occupations of the people are farming and fishing, while the major religion is Christianity with a few adherents to African Traditional Religion. The main Ethnic groups in the LGA are Abua and Odual. There are 25 functional Primary Health Facilities spread across the LGA and a General Hospital located at Ayama, Central Abua.

The LGA Health Authority & Technical Committee

The Local Government Primary Health Care Authority and the Primary Health Care Technical Committee are responsible for the management and implementation of Primary Health Care activities and services at the LGA level. The health authority is the operational arm of the Rivers State Primary Health Care Management Board. It has the chairman of the local government as the Committee Chairman and the Medical Officer of Health as the Secretary.
The PHC Technical committee is composed of the Medical Officer of Health who serves as the chairman, the Deputy PHC Coordinator, the Programme Managers of the LGA, and the heads of facilities. This committee meets once a month to discuss issues bordering on health service delivery and improvement. The following are the list of members of the committee.
  1. Hon. Chairman (or a representative) (Committee chairman)
  2. PHC Coordinator/MOH (Committee Secretary)
  3. LGA Supervisory Councilor for Health
  4. Head of Finance in the LGA
  5. Representative of LGA in charge of water (Head of Environmental Health Unit)
  6. Representative of LGA programme officers
  7. Representatives of heads of PHCs in the LGA
  8. One representative from the communities in the LGA
